What is a home energy audit?

home energy audit is conducted by a certified professional who evaluates your home’s energy efficiency and helps you come up with an actionable plan about how to fix any problems they find. You’ll discover how much energy your home uses and the professional will be able to tell you where your home may have comfort issues in the coming hot/cold seasons. From your attic to your crawlspace and your ductwork to your furnace, there are many pieces and systems in your home that must work together for it to function properly. A home energy auditor will evaluate all the systems in your home to understand how they impact your comfort and health.

How do I know if I need a home energy audit?

There are a few common symptoms that indicate a home is not energy efficient, including high energy and utility bills, ice dams, window condensation, temperature fluctuations throughout the home, rooms that vary in temperature depending on the season, and indoor air quality issues. As a new owner, it can be difficult to know what the previous owners have done in terms of energy system upgrades. A home auditor can help you identify and correct any energy efficiency issues the previous owners failed to address to ensure you don’t experience the same problems.

What are the benefits of a home energy audit?

Home energy audits are extremely beneficial for new homeowners. Having your home audited and then making the recommended changes directly impacts your wallet, your health, and the planet. An auditor can help you prioritize your energy efficiency improvements, so you can enjoy a healthy and comfortable new home. 

The process can help you save money on your energy bills because the auditor will go right to the source to find out where energy is escaping and being wasted. You will also find that your home’s overall level of comfort will be improved. You’ll no longer experience a hot second floor in the summer and cold, drafty rooms in the winter. If you have weak insulation in your attic or crawlspace, for example, your home’s temperature will be more stable from room to room after new insulation is installed. An energy audit can also improve the health and safety of your home. Your auditor will be able to discover and identify problems such as mold or structural issues before they become severe and costly. Lastly, having a professional audit of your new home can also benefit the environment. You’ll use less energy, meaning your carbon footprint and the pollution you produce will be reduced.
